Colleen Ooten joins TricorBraun as director of supply chain

Colleen Ooten has joined TricorBraun as Director of Supply Chain to oversee the company’s supply chain operations in its Central Division, which includes Canada and the central U.S.

She will be based in the TricorBraun Woodridge, IL office.

This new position has been created to support TricorBraun’s operations by further strengthening the established relationships among the company, its customers and its vendors to maximize value in the marketplace for each of them. Ooten’s role will include coordinating new technologies and new materials brought to TricorBraun by its suppliers with the changing needs of its customers and the consumers they serve.

“Colleen is a great addition to our team, and she is already creating value for TricorBraun.Her 14 years of experience in packaging, professionalism, industry insight, and her dedication to bottom-line results brings a foundation we can build on,” said Mark Polivka, TricorBraun Executive Vice President of Supply Chain Management, in announcing Ooten’s appointment.

The Director of Supply Chain will be one of three aligned with each TricorBraun Division and will be responsible for integrating with the Divisional Executive Vice President, the three Regional Vice Presidents and the more than thirty-five Packaging Consultants in that Division.

Ooten comes to TricorBraun from Diageo, where she was most recently Director of Strategic Initiatives, and prior to that Operations Business Services Director/Packaging and Innovation Business Manager. She is a graduate of Rutgers University.
